The sneaker that started it all for Nike's Free series and revolutionized running celebrates its 10th anniversary. The Free 5.0 OG returns in a murdered-out vibe as part of the Swoosh's commemorative "Genealogy of Free" pack.
The runner features an all-black upper constructed of a perforated suede and a mesh inner bootie for max comfort. There's tonal black hits on the Swoosh, heel panel, and just above the midsole to complete the monochromatic theme. Underneath, which is the main attraction of the sneaker, sits a cement grey Free 5.0 midsole that was developed to mimic barefoot running. The sneaker's flexible properties and unique midsole design help promote a more natural landing for the wearer, and is a concept that has transitioned to numerous styles in Nike's running catalog.
